首页
/ 无需模拟器?在Windows上流畅运行Android应用的创新方案

无需模拟器?在Windows上流畅运行Android应用的创新方案

2026-05-03 09:27:19作者:胡易黎Nicole

在数字化办公与多设备协同的今天,Windows Android兼容已成为提升工作效率的关键需求。无论是处理移动办公应用还是测试跨平台软件,用户都渴望一种无需复杂配置即可实现跨平台应用运行的解决方案。WSABuilds项目通过深度整合Windows Subsystem for Android(WSA)技术,让普通用户也能轻松搭建稳定高效的Android运行环境,彻底改变传统模拟器卡顿、资源占用高的痛点。

一、为什么选择WSABuilds:突破传统方案的核心优势

主流Android运行方案对比分析

方案类型 启动速度 系统资源占用 应用兼容性 操作便捷性 适用场景
传统模拟器 较慢(30-60秒) 高(4GB+内存) 一般 需手动配置 游戏娱乐
虚拟机方案 慢(1-3分钟) 极高(8GB+内存) 专业知识要求高 开发测试
WSABuilds 快(10-15秒) 中(2-4GB内存) 优秀 一键安装 日常办公/应用测试

WSABuilds独特价值

  • 原生系统级整合:基于微软官方WSA技术,实现与Windows系统的深度融合
  • 预装核心组件:内置Google Play服务、Magiskroot工具和KernelSU权限管理
  • 多架构支持:完美适配x86_64和arm64两种主流处理器架构
  • 持续更新维护:活跃的开发社区提供定期更新和问题修复

二、系统环境准备:条件检查与配置要点

兼容性预检清单

  1. 操作系统版本验证

    • Windows 11需满足版本22000.526或更高
    • Windows 10 22H2需达到版本10.0.19045.2311以上
    • ⚠️注意:通过winver命令可快速查看系统版本信息
  2. 硬件配置要求

    • 内存:至少8GB(推荐16GB以获得流畅体验)
    • 存储:系统盘可用空间≥10GB,SSD硬盘可显著提升性能
    • 处理器:支持硬件虚拟化技术的x86_64或arm64架构CPU

系统虚拟化支持启用步骤

  1. 目标:开启Windows系统虚拟化功能
  2. 操作
    • 按下Win+R打开运行窗口,输入appwiz.cpl
    • 在左侧导航栏选择"启用或关闭Windows功能"
    • 勾选"虚拟机平台"和"Windows Hypervisor平台"选项
    • 点击确定并重启计算机
  3. 验证:重启后通过任务管理器→性能→CPU,确认"虚拟化"状态为"已启用"

三、分步骤实施:从获取到运行的完整指南

1. 项目资源获取

  1. 目标:获取WSABuilds项目源码
  2. 操作
    • 打开Windows终端(PowerShell或命令提示符)
    • 执行以下命令克隆项目仓库:
      git clone https://gitcode.com/GitHub_Trending/ws/WSABuilds
      
  3. 验证:检查目标文件夹是否包含"MagiskOnWSA"和"installer"等核心目录

2. 构建版本选择

  1. 目标:选择适合需求的WSA配置版本
  2. 操作
    • 进入项目目录中的"installer"文件夹
    • 根据需求选择对应架构的安装包(x64或arm64)
    • 版本类型说明:
      • 含Google Play服务版:适合需要完整Android生态的用户
      • Magisk/KernelSU版:适合需要root权限的高级用户
      • 纯净版:适合追求轻量运行的用户
  3. 验证:确认所选版本与系统架构匹配(可通过"设置→系统→关于"查看设备规格)

3. 安装流程执行

  1. 目标:完成WSA环境的自动化部署
  2. 操作
    • 双击运行"Run.bat"文件启动安装向导
    • 根据提示选择安装选项(建议保留默认设置)
    • 等待安装程序自动下载必要组件(需保持网络连接)
    • 安装完成后会自动启动WSA设置界面
  3. 验证:在Windows开始菜单中出现"Windows Subsystem for Android"图标

四、场景化应用:从基础到进阶的使用指南

办公应用适配案例

场景:在Windows中运行企业内部Android办公应用

  1. 打开WSA设置,启用"开发人员模式"
  2. 通过ADB命令安装APK文件:adb install appname.apk
  3. 在开始菜单找到并固定应用快捷方式
  4. 💡技巧:通过"文件"应用可实现Windows与Android系统间文件互传

生产力提升方案

  • 多任务处理:Android应用可与Windows程序并排显示,实现跨系统剪贴板共享
  • 通知整合:Android应用通知直接显示在Windows通知中心
  • 性能优化:在WSA设置中调整资源分配(建议分配4GB内存以获得最佳体验)

五、进阶技巧:优化配置与问题解决

性能调优建议

  • 📌重点提示:通过WSA设置→系统→资源,调整CPU核心数和内存分配
  • 启用"图形加速"可提升应用渲染性能(需支持DirectX 11的显卡)
  • 关闭后台不必要的Android应用以释放系统资源

常见问题解决方案

  1. 安装失败(错误代码0x80073CF9)

    • 检查系统虚拟化功能是否已正确启用
    • 确保Windows更新至最新版本
    • 尝试以管理员身份运行安装脚本
  2. 应用闪退或无法启动

    • 确认应用与WSA架构兼容(x86_64/arm64)
    • 尝试清除应用数据:设置→应用→选择应用→清除数据
    • 查看项目文档中的"Fix Guides"目录获取针对性解决方案

六、相关工具推荐

  • WSA控制器:项目内置的"WSABuilds Utilities"提供便捷的更新和管理功能
  • APK安装工具:推荐使用"WSA-Sideloader"实现图形化APK安装(位于项目"Documentation/Usage Guides/Sideloading Guides"目录)
  • 文件管理:通过"WSAFiles"工具实现Windows与Android系统文件无缝访问

通过WSABuilds方案,用户无需复杂配置即可在Windows系统上获得原生级的Android应用体验。无论是办公需求还是开发测试,这种创新方案都提供了高效、稳定且资源友好的跨平台解决方案,重新定义了Windows与Android的协同工作方式。随着项目的持续发展,未来还将支持更多高级功能和应用场景,值得用户持续关注和体验。

登录后查看全文
热门项目推荐
相关项目推荐